Modul:Chronik/Work: Unterschied zwischen den Versionen

keine Bearbeitungszusammenfassung
Keine Bearbeitungszusammenfassung
Keine Bearbeitungszusammenfassung
Zeile 1: Zeile 1:
local p = {}
local p = {}
local str = require("Modul:String")
local str = require("Modul:String")
local c = require("Modul:Common")


function p.dateParser(s, year)
function p.dateParser(s, year)
dates = str.split(s, "-")
dates = str.split(s, "-")
-- Wenn splitten mit "-" nur ein Ergebnis bringt, splitte mit "bis"
-- Wenn splitten mit "-" nur ein Ergebnis bringt, splitte mit "bis"
if len(dates) == 1 then
if c.len(dates) == 1 then
dates = str.split(s, "bis")
dates = str.split(s, "bis")
end
end
Zeile 16: Zeile 17:
     mw.log(value)  -- oder print(value), wenn du es direkt in der Konsole sehen möchtest
     mw.log(value)  -- oder print(value), wenn du es direkt in der Konsole sehen möchtest
end
end
return s, year
return dates[1], dates[2], year
end
end


return p
return p
82.367

Bearbeitungen